Web16 mrt. 2024 · If you’re covered by an HSA-eligible health plan (or high-deductible health plan ), the IRS allows you to put as much as $3,650 per year (in 2024) into your health savings account (HSA). If you’re contributing to an HSA, and on a family HDHP, the maximum amount that you can contribute is $7,300 per year (in 2024).
